Comment:
The idea was to make a country-esque mix without the use of uncle tupelo/wilco/son volt songs (which I sometimes lean on too heavily), and I nearly made it, but right near the end of side two, somehow, without my consent, that son volt song crept in there. Regardless, a good tape for sitting on the porch out of the sun, sipping something cold and swatting the flies. Reminds me of summer (made the tape back in July).Feedback:
